## Data Stores: Renderloft Transcoding Farm

The Renderloft farm tracks every transcode job in a dedicated Postgres instance. Workers claim rows from `jobs_pending` using advisory locks, so review any schema change carefully for lock compatibility. Job payloads are immutable after enqueue; state transitions are audited in `jobs_history`. When verifying migrations locally, connect to the staging instance using the string below.

primary connection of yagep-kahip = redis://giliel_svc:zYiKsLL2PLpfPL@db-348f.xolmarsys.corp:5432/fenwyn

## Deploying the Gatewick Proctor Queue

Deploys are pretty painless: push to main, wait for the pipeline, then watch the queue drain dashboard for five minutes. If candidates pile up mid-exam, roll back first and ask questions later — the queue replays safely. Everything the workers care about lives in one config block, shown here for reference.

settings of bafof-yagef:
JOROX_PIN=8740
JOROX_TENANT=pelox
JOROX_METRICS_HOST=metrics.jorox.qorvelworks.internal
JOROX_SEAL=seal_c78f63c1
JOROX_STANDBY_TEAM=norax

Account recovery for FareForge, the rules engine that computes shipping fees at Lintwharf Systems, follows a fixed sequence. If the service account is locked after three failed rotations, restore access through the recovery console rather than editing the credential store by hand. Reviewers should verify that any patch touching the recovery path preserves the audit hook in the unlock handler. Unlocking the console prompts for the standing recovery passphrase, which for reference during review appears on the next line.

unlock words, fahop-tagug: oliath-oliwyn